I need a part number and place to order a good 1 notch head gasket. I would also like to know what head studs to order and where as I dont want to use the stock bolts. I am building a 1.6 HYD with a 1.9 HYD head on it. I am also adding a t3 turbo. The pump is stock, just rebuilt with new injectors. I was also wondering what the timing should be, I ve read as much as 1.25mm for extra advance. Suggestions? Thanks

I used a 2 notch head gasket. I played with timing for a long time until I settled on 1.00
With a aaz k14 an intercooler running 17lbs of boost, gov mod and pump tuning, I can do a 0-60 run in 9.5s and not be above 875f egts. Cruising at 60-65mph is 500-600 on flat, no higher than 750f on the steepest highway grade going 60mph. Hard to get it above 950f period. Now I am worried about slipping the clutch, it has a 16v clutch, but rolling in 2nd if I lay into it it will break the tires free. It pulls so hard in 4th that it hurts my neck if I do it a few times.
intercooling is what turned my motor from pretty good, to holy crap.

1 hole (1.53mm) 028 103 383BH
2 hole (1.57mm) 028 103 383BJ
3 hole (1.61mm) 028 103 383BK
world impex has them I believe

I would start off timing it at the normal 1.00mm. From here all you can really do is time it by ear/performance. It will need to be advanced until it stops missing at idle and the smoke clears up but stop before the clattering gets worse. It's a trial and error thing when you are building a hybrid engine.

BTW - the gasket i linked is the fiber style 1.6 (stock).
Happened to wonder if you were actually wanting a 1.9 Multi Layer Steel head gasket.
The fiber with studs - supposed to be good to about 20-25 psi boost.
The MLS goes up to higher psi boost.
But requires very strait deck and head tolerances.
